1. Wprowadzenie
The Dragino T68DL Temperature sensor is a Long Range LoRaWAN Sensor with an IP68 waterproof rating. It is designed to allow users to send data over extremely long ranges, providing ultra-long range spread spectrum communication and high interference immunity while minimizing current consumption. This sensor is ideal for professional wireless sensor network applications such as irrigation systems, smart metering, smart cities, and building automation.
The T68DL features a built-in 2400mAh non-chargeable battery, offering a lifespan of up to 10 years*. It is fully compatible with the LoRaWAN v1.0.3 Class A protocol, enabling seamless operation with any standard LoRaWAN gateway.
A key feature of the T68DL is its Datalog capability. This allows the device to record data even when network coverage is unavailable, ensuring that no sensor readings are missed. Users can retrieve this stored data later.
*The actual battery life depends on the frequency of data transmission. Refer to the battery analyzer chapter (if available in full documentation) for more details.

4. Specyfikacje
4.1. Built-in Temperature Sensor
- Rezolucja: 0.01 °C
- Tolerancja dokładności: Typowo ±0.3 °C
- Długoterminowy dryf: < 0.02 °C/rok
- Zasięg działania: -40 ~ 85 °C

7. Konfiguracja
To set up your Dragino T68DL sensor:
- Rozpakować: Carefully remove the T68DL sensor from its packaging.
- Początkowa aktywacja: The sensor is typically shipped in a low-power mode. Refer to the specific product documentation or the manufacturer's website for details on initial activation, which may involve pressing a button or connecting to a configuration tool.
- LoRaWAN Configuration: Configure the sensor with your LoRaWAN network server details (e.g., Device EUI, Application EUI, Application Key). This is often done via AT commands through a serial interface or remotely via LoRaWAN Downlink commands.
- Umieszczenie: Mount the sensor in the desired location, ensuring it is within range of your LoRaWAN gateway. The IP68 rating allows for outdoor and harsh environment placement.
- Weryfikacja: Verify that the sensor is successfully joining the LoRaWAN network and transmitting data. The tri-color LED can provide status indications during this process.

8. Instrukcja obsługi
Once configured and deployed, the T68DL operates autonomously, periodically transmitting temperature data to your LoRaWAN network server. Key operational aspects include:
- Transmisja danych: The sensor will transmit temperature readings at intervals defined during configuration.
- Rejestracja danych: If network connectivity is lost, the sensor will store data internally. This data can be retrieved once connectivity is re-established or through specific commands.
- Wskaźniki LED: Observe the tri-color LED for operational status. Consult the full product manual for specific LED patterns and their meanings.
- Zdalna konfiguracja: Parameters such as transmission interval or alarm thresholds can be adjusted remotely via LoRaWAN Downlink messages from your network server.
9. Konserwacja
The Dragino T68DL is designed for low maintenance due to its long battery life and robust IP68 enclosure. However, consider the following:
- Czas pracy baterii: The internal 2400mAh battery is non-chargeable and designed for up to 10 years of operation. Monitor battery levels via LoRaWAN payloads if supported by your network server. Battery replacement is not user-serviceable.
- Czyszczenie: Periodically clean the exterior of the sensor, especially if deployed in dusty or dirty environments, to ensure optimal performance and longevity. Use a soft, damp płótno. Nie używaj ostrych chemikaliów.
- Aktualizacje oprogramowania układowego: Sprawdź Dragino website for any available firmware updates. Updates can improve performance, add features, or address issues. Firmware upgrades are performed via the program port.
- Zagadnienia dotyczące ochrony środowiska: While IP68 rated, avoid prolonged submersion beyond specified limits or exposure to extreme physical stress.
10. Rozwiązywanie Problemów
If you encounter issues with your T68DL sensor, consider these common troubleshooting steps:
- Brak transmisji danych:
- Check LoRaWAN gateway connectivity and range.
- Verify LoRaWAN network server configuration (Device EUI, App EUI, App Key).
- Ensure the sensor is activated and not in a sleep mode.
- Check the tri-color LED for error indications.
- Niedokładne odczyty:
- Ensure the sensor is not exposed to direct sunlight or other localized heat sources that could skew readings.
- Verify the sensor's operating range (-40 ~ 85 °C) is not exceeded.
- Datalogging Issues:
- Confirm the datalogging feature is enabled in the sensor's configuration.
- Ensure sufficient internal memory for storing data.
- Problemy z łącznością:
- Relocate the sensor or gateway to improve signal strength.
- Check for potential interference sources.
For persistent issues, consult the detailed technical documentation available on the Dragino website or contact Dragino support.
